Inclusion Criteria

1.Patient with diagnosis of T10 neurological level or below on American Spinal Injury

Association Impairment Scale (AISA)

2.ASIA Impairment grade A or B.

3.Spinal cord injury subjects at least 3 months post injury with a stable spine and

no significant kyphoscoliotic deformity.

4.All participants will be between 15 to 45 years old.

5.The ability to ambulate independently with bilateral KAFOs for a minimum of

10m using assistive devices

Exclusion Criteria

1.Any associated injuries ,head injury; lower-limb and upper-limb fractures.
